Caitlin Foord scored the opening goal of Australia’s 2-1 win against China in the semi-final of the AFC Women’s Asian Cup on Tuesday.

She fired Matildas in front in the 17th minute with her 40th Australia goal and, after Zhang Linyan reduced the arrears from the penalty spot, Sam Kerr scored the winning goal in the second half, assisted by Foord.

Steph Catley was back in the starting line-up and played the full 90 minutes, as did Foord, while Kyra Cooney-Cross played 79 minutes.

The win means Australia are through to Saturday’s final, which will kick off at 9am UK time against either South Korea or Japan, with those two sides playing the other semi-final on Wednesday.
